Output 56e8d415d43ec998f862efbc67885c5c036736c756883539175f542e6ed14c1c:59

value
578209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2094a03ca0144de9d86023c0546476a857e39bf8 OP_EQUAL
address
34fHbPj6Wk7VYeqQ3GZ2rZr4p3d6qerc9r
transaction
56e8d415d43ec998f862efbc67885c5c036736c756883539175f542e6ed14c1c